| Age | Commit message (Collapse) | Author | |
|---|---|---|---|
| 2022-01-04 | Clean useless database arguments (4/5) | Samantaz Fox | |
| 2022-01-04 | Clean useless database arguments (3/5) | Samantaz Fox | |
| 2022-01-04 | Clean useless database arguments (2/5) | Samantaz Fox | |
| 2022-01-04 | Clean useless database arguments (1/5) | Samantaz Fox | |
| 2022-01-04 | Move DB utility functions to the proper module |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to 'annotations' in a separate module |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to playlists in a separate module (3/3) |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to 'users' in a separate module (2/2) |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to 'users' in a separate module (1/2) |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to session tokens in a separate module |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to channels in a separate module |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to statistics in a separate module |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to playlists in a separate module (2/3) |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to playlists in a separate module (1/3) | Samantaz Fox | |
| 2022-01-04 | Move DB queries related to 'videos' in a separate module | Samantaz Fox | |
| 2022-01-04 | Also fix DISABLE_QUIC declaration | Samantaz Fox | |
| 2022-01-04 | Flag to disable QUIC should be 'disable_quic' | Samantaz Fox | |
| 2021-12-22 | Add the Invidious's Mastodon account to the README | TheFrenchGhosty | |
| 2021-12-22 | i18n: Add Serbian back | Samantaz Fox | |
| 2021-12-21 | Update Indonesian transl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: I. Musthafa <i.musthafa66@gmail.com> | |||
| 2021-12-21 | Update Chinese (Traditional) transl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Jeff Huang <s8321414@gmail.com> | |||
| 2021-12-21 | Update Turkish transl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Oğuz Ersen <oguzersen@protonmail.com> | |||
| 2021-12-21 | Update French translation | Hosted Weblate | |
| Update French translation Co-authored-by: Bundy01 <bundy@posteo.eu>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Samantaz Fox <translator-weblate@samantaz.fr> | |||
| 2021-12-21 | Update Arabic transl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Rex_sa <rex.sa@pm.me> | |||
| 2021-12-21 | Update Japanese translation | Hosted Weblate | |
| Co-authored-by: GnuPGを使うべきだ <dieeeazpnnqbpddh@cock.email> Co-authored-by: Hosted Weblate <hosted@weblate.org> | |||
| 2021-12-21 | Update Norwegian Bokmål translation | Hosted Weblate | |
| Co-authored-by: Allan Nordhøy <epost@anotheragency.no> Co-authored-by: Hosted Weblate <hosted@weblate.org> | |||
| 2021-12-21 | Update Spanish transl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Jorge Maldonado Ventura <jorgesumle@freakspot.net> | |||
| 2021-12-19 | Fix XSS vulnerability in channel playlists | Samantaz Fox | |
| The channel/<ucid>/playlists page was vulnerable to Cross Site Scripting (XSS), because the different URL parameters were inserted as-is in the URL meant for instance switching. This vulnerability could allow an attacker to inject malicious Javascript in the page by tricking the user to click on a crafted link. Bug introduced in commit 66e7285108363c3c3dcb814bdffb716c14e1724d ("Only use /redirect when automatically redirecting"). Thanks to Jack (@testa:cthd.icu on Matrix, @cysea on github) for responsibly reporting this issue! | |||
| 2021-12-17 | Extractors: Add support for shorts | Samantaz Fox | |
| Fixes #2708 | |||
| 2021-12-16 | Update Norwegian Bokmål translation | Hosted Weblate | |
| Co-authored-by: Petter Reinholdtsen <pere-weblate@hungry.com> | |||
| 2021-12-15 | Allow the t parameter to override the stored video playback position | bbielsa | |
| 2021-12-15 | Fix formatting of preferences.cr and videos.cr | bbielsa | |
| 2021-12-15 | Use localization for save player position label in the preferences page | bbielsa | |
| 2021-12-15 | Rename 'remember_position' to 'save_player_pos' for clarity | bbielsa | |
| 2021-12-15 | Added default value for get_video_time() which was causing a bug in safari | bbielsa | |
| 2021-12-15 | Remove console.log debugging | bbielsa | |
| 2021-12-15 | Save and load the position for the video using a local storage object, the ↵ | bbielsa | |
| object is a dictionary, where the key is the video ID, and the value is the time at which the user last left off watching the video. If the user deselected the 'remember video position' checkbox in the preferences this dictionary is cleared | |||
| 2021-12-15 | Add remember_position field to the Preferences and VideoPreferences structs, ↵ | bbielsa | |
| and add a checkbox in the preferences page to toggle it | |||
| 2021-12-12 | locales: use "DASH" instead of "dash" in en-US | Samantaz Fox | |
| 2021-12-10 | Update Danish translation | Hosted Weblate | |
| Update Danish translation Update Danish translation Update Danish translation Update Danish translation Update Danish translation Co-authored-by: Grooty12 <Rasmus@rosendahl-kaa.name> Co-authored-by: HackerNCoder <hackerncoder@protonmail.ch> Co-authored-by: Hosted Weblate <hosted@weblate.org> | |||
| 2021-12-10 | Update Indonesian transl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: I. Musthafa <i.musthafa66@gmail.com> | |||
| 2021-12-10 | Update Dutch transl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Issa1553 <fairfull.playing@gmail.com> | |||
| 2021-12-10 | Update Chinese (Traditional) transl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Jeff Huang <s8321414@gmail.com> | |||
| 2021-12-10 | Update Turkish transl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Oğuz Ersen <oguzersen@protonmail.com> | |||
| 2021-12-10 | Update Chinese (Simplified) translation | Hosted Weblate | |
| Co-authored-by: Eric <spice2wolf@gmail.com> Co-authored-by: Hosted Weblate <hosted@weblate.org> | |||
| 2021-12-10 | Update Serbian (cyrillic) transl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Issa1553 <fairfull.playing@gmail.com> | |||
| 2021-12-10 | Update Serbian transl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Issa1553 <fairfull.playing@gmail.com> | |||
| 2021-12-10 | Update Croatian translation | Hosted Weblate | |
| Update Croatian translation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Issa1553 <fairfull.playing@gmail.com> Co-authored-by: Milo Ivir <mail@milotype.de> | |||
| 2021-12-10 | Update French translation | Hosted Weblate | |
| Update French translation Co-authored-by: Bundy01 <bundy@posteo.eu>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Samantaz Fox <translator-weblate@samantaz.fr> | |||
| 2021-12-10 | Update German translation | Hosted Weblate | |
| Co-authored-by: Hosted Weblate <hosted@weblate.org> Co-authored-by: Issa1553 <fairfull.playing@gmail.com> | |||
